  1. Question 1

    Q1. A 30-year-old woman with PCOS experiences irregular menstrual cycles. What hormone imbalance is primarily responsible for this symptom?

    • A) High estrogen and low progesterone
    • B) High progesterone and low estrogen
    • C) High androgen and low estrogen
    • D) Low FSH and high LH

    Answer: Low FSH and high LH

    Explanation: High LH disrupts ovulation, PCOS characteristic.
